
Goolawah Co-operative, established in 2000, is a rural land-sharing community situated between Port Macquarie and Crescent Head in New South Wales, Australia. Spanning 1,600 acres of diverse coastal vegetation, the co-op comprises 78 residential sites, each approximately 5,000 square meters, organized into several hamlets connected by a link road. Members live off the grid, utilizing solar energy, rainwater collection, and composting toilets, with many cultivating gardens to supplement their food supplies. Community activities include building projects, a Men's Shed, music performances, and environmental conservation efforts. The co-op reflects a diverse membership, encompassing families, singles, and individuals with varied life experiences and occupations.
